Sternarchorhynchus severii is a slender, tube-snouted ghost knifefish described from a single fast-flowing tributary of the Amazon basin in Brazil, one of dozens of similar-looking Sternarchorhynchus species that ichthyologists distinguish mainly by snout shape and fine anatomical detail. Like every member of its family it is a bony fish with an unusual trick: it generates a weak electric field around its body and reads the way that field is distorted by rocks, prey and other fish, a sense called electrolocation that lets it navigate and hunt in water where eyes are of little use. It swims by rippling a single long fin beneath a scaleless, eel-like body, moving backward as easily as forward, and it produces a fast, continuous wave-type electric discharge rather than the pulsing signal of some other knifefish groups. It is essentially unknown in the aquarium trade — a fish that lives out its life in the swift, oxygen-rich water below Amazonian rapids, far from any collector's net.

Taxonomy & naming

Sternarchorhynchus severii was described by de Santana & Nogueira in 2006 in Ichthyological Exploration of Freshwaters, based on a holotype male of 6.5 in total length (INPA 22893) collected from the Rio Mucajaí system in Roraima, Brazil. It belongs to the family Apteronotidae — the ghost knifefishes — within the order Gymnotiformes, the New-World electric knifefishes, and more specifically to the subfamily Apteronotinae. The Catalog of Fishes (Eschmeyer, CAS) lists it as a valid name with no synonyms recorded.

The genus Sternarchorhynchus is one of the most species-rich in the family, and its members are notoriously difficult to tell apart, distinguished largely by the length and curvature of the tubular snout and by fine details of dentition and squamation rather than by colour pattern. The species epithet honours William Severi, a Brazilian biologist recognised for his contribution to the study of the fish fauna of northeastern Brazil. Despite the shared common name "knifefish", Sternarchorhynchus and the rest of the Gymnotiformes are not related to the Asian featherback or clown knifefishes (Chitala, Notopterus); the resemblance is convergent body shape, not kinship.

Morphology

Like other members of its genus, Sternarchorhynchus severii has the classic "tube-snout" ghost knifefish body plan: an elongated, laterally compressed, scaleless body that tapers to a fine point at the tail, with no dorsal fin and no true caudal fin. A long tubular snout, ending in a small mouth, is the genus's signature feature and is thought to aid in probing crevices and substrate for hidden prey. Propulsion comes almost entirely from a long ribbon-like anal fin that runs beneath most of the body, its travelling waves driving the fish forward or backward with equal ease. FishBase records a maximum length of 6.5 in total length for the species, modest even by the standards of the tube-snouted knifefishes.

As in all Apteronotidae, the electric organ is derived from modified nerve tissue rather than muscle, which allows it to fire at very high, steady frequencies — among Apteronotidae generally, wave-type discharges recorded in the family run from roughly 420 to 2,179 Hz, continuous and sinusoidal rather than pulsed. That signal, read by sensory pores across the skin, is both a sonar for the dark and a badge of identity broadcast to every other fish nearby. Sexual dimorphism has not been documented for this species.

Habitat

Sternarchorhynchus severii is known from the Rio Mucajaí system in Roraima, in the Brazilian Amazon, with its type locality below a set of rapids (Cachoeira Paredão 2). FishBase describes the water there as acidic (around pH 5.8) and well-oxygenated, flowing past steep banks and a forest-bordered shoreline where beds of aquatic plants of the family Podostemaceae — plants specialised for growth on rocks in fast currents — cling to the streambed.

More broadly, Sternarchorhynchus as a genus is associated with high-energy stream habitats: rapids, waterfalls and the swift water immediately below them, a niche distinct from the sluggish backwaters and flooded forest favoured by some other gymnotiforms. This species in particular is reported from smaller tributaries and streams within the Amazon basin rather than the main river channel. As in other Apteronotidae, the electric sense is put to use in exactly this kind of turbulent, often turbid water, where vision alone would be a poor guide to what lies ahead.

Feeding

Detailed dietary data for Sternarchorhynchus severii has not been published, but the genus's tubular snout is widely interpreted as an adaptation for probing narrow spaces — crevices between rocks, leaf litter and plant beds — for small invertebrate prey. Like other Apteronotidae, it is presumed to hunt primarily by electrolocation, sensing the electrical signature of buried or hidden prey rather than relying on sight, and to be most active after dark.

Given the fast, well-oxygenated water it inhabits, its likely prey base is aquatic insect larvae and other small benthic invertebrates typical of rapids and riffle habitats, in keeping with the diet recorded for related tube-snouted knifefishes. Specific feeding data for this species is data sparse.

Mating

As in other Apteronotidae, the wave-type electric organ discharge in Sternarchorhynchus is understood to carry information about a fish's identity, sex and size, and courtship in the family is thought to unfold partly as an exchange of electric signals in the dark rather than through visual display. This has been studied in detail in a handful of laboratory species such as the brown ghost knifefish, where males and females shift discharge frequency toward one another during courtship.

No courtship or mating behaviour has been documented specifically for Sternarchorhynchus severii. It is presumed to follow the same broad Apteronotidae pattern of electric-signal-mediated approach, but this remains inferred from the family rather than observed in the species itself — data sparse.

Breeding

Sternarchorhynchus severii is an egg-layer, as are all Gymnotiformes, but its reproduction in the wild and in captivity is essentially undocumented. Encyclopedia of Life notes that sexual reproduction is confirmed for the genus but that breeding details remain unpublished, and the species is not established in the aquarium trade, so there is no hobbyist breeding record to draw on either.

No parental care has been reported for the species or, more broadly, for the tube-snouted Apteronotidae. Given how poorly studied this genus is outside of taxonomic description, any specific claim about spawning site, egg number or incubation would be guesswork; the honest summary is that breeding is rarely observed and poorly documented.

In the aquarium

Sternarchorhynchus severii is not a fish of the aquarium trade. It is known only from scientific collection in a remote stretch of the Rio Mucajaí system, and — unlike the popular black ghost knifefish — has no established husbandry record, wild-caught or otherwise. Sources describing the wider genus note that Sternarchorhynchus species are rarely seen in the trade and, when they do appear, are typically wild-caught rather than farm-bred.

Were a specimen ever to be kept, the general precautions that apply to all ghost knifefish would apply doubly here: it is scaleless and therefore sensitive to ammonia, nitrate and copper-based medications, which should be avoided or heavily reduced; and as a fish adapted to fast, well-oxygenated, acidic rapids water, it would need strong flow, high dissolved oxygen and stable, soft, acidic conditions that are difficult to replicate in a typical home aquarium. This is a species to know about, not a species to shop for.

Conservation

Sternarchorhynchus severii is assessed by the IUCN as Vulnerable, reflecting its apparent restriction to the Rio Mucajaí system in Roraima, Brazil — the kind of narrow-range, single-basin distribution that makes many tube-snouted Apteronotidae inherently more exposed than wide-ranging relatives such as the black ghost knifefish. A species confined to one river system can be disproportionately affected by localised pressures — changes in water quality, damming or flow alteration, deforestation of the surrounding catchment — that a continent-spanning species could simply outlast elsewhere in its range.

The species is not part of the aquarium trade, so collection for the hobby is not a relevant threat; conservation attention here belongs with habitat protection in the Mucajaí basin itself. As with many gymnotiforms outside the handful of trade staples, basic ecological and population data remain sparse, which is itself a conservation-relevant gap.
